WebHow do I stop my dog being aggressive towards visitors? Often, the use of treats or favorite toys is involved so that the dog learns that all visitors have something fun and wonderful to offer. When a dog has grasped the strong connection between visitors and good things, happiness can replace fear as the dog's response to people coming to the ... Others though can become aggressive, barking, and even trying to attack in some instances. powasertWeb2 jan. 2024 · For conditioning to occur, two critical steps must take place. Step 1: The antecedent or “trigger” must be noticed (seen, heard, smelled). Step 2: Reinforcer must occur immediately (food or toy). It is important that the reward comes immediately and before the dog starts offering unwanted behavior. poward plasticsWebIn this clip, I work with my client's protective Malinois and help her curb his barking at people who come to her home. ...
